我正在升级一个大型构建系统以使用Maven2而不是Ant,我们有两个相关的要求,我坚持:
我们需要生成一个带时间戳的工件,因此是包 阶段(或任何地方)的一部分,而不是构建
project-1.0-SNAPSHOT.jar
Run Code Online (Sandbox Code Playgroud)
我们应该建设
project-1.0-20090803125803.jar
Run Code Online (Sandbox Code Playgroud)
(这
20090803125803只是YYYYMMDDHHMMSS罐子制造时的时间戳).
唯一真正的要求是时间戳是生成文件的文件名的一部分.
必须在生成的jar 内的version.properties文件中包含相同的时间戳.
当您运行时,此信息包含在生成的pom.properties中,例如,mvn package但已被注释掉:
#Generated by Maven
#Mon Aug 03 12:57:17 PDT 2009
Run Code Online (Sandbox Code Playgroud)
任何关于从哪里开始的想法都会有所帮助!谢谢!
我正在开发一个ASP.NET 3.5 Web应用程序,我允许我的用户上传jpeg,gif,bmp或png图像.如果上传的图片尺寸大于103 x 32,我想将上传的图片大小调整为103 x 32.我已经阅读了一些博文和文章,并且还尝试了一些代码示例,但似乎没有什么工作正常.有没有人成功做到这一点?
我正在寻找一个很好的API文档,特别是与浏览器和DOM相关的Javascript.我不是在寻找任何类型的Javascript教程,而只是所有标准Javascript类和Web浏览器中使用的类的文档.
类似于Java的Javadoc(http://java.sun.com/j2se/1.4.2/docs/api/)
如何在HTML页面中将XML文档显示为可折叠和可扩展的树?
我想在HTML页面中显示一个XML文档,作为一个非常漂亮的打印树结构.我希望能够扩展和折叠树枝.例如,Firefox浏览器在加载纯XML文件时执行此操作.我正在寻找如何使用JavaScript在客户端执行此操作.
我有一个地址将显示在网页上,但它不是该页面作者的地址.考虑到w3c的推荐,如何将其编码为语义:
作者可以使用ADDRESS元素来提供文档的联系信息或文档的主要部分,例如表单.此元素通常出现在文档的开头或结尾.
有人可以用直观的方式解释strassen的矩阵乘法算法吗?我已经完成了(好了,试图通过)书中的解释和维基,但它没有点击楼上.网络上使用大量英语而非正式表示法等的任何链接也会有所帮助.是否有任何类比可以帮助我从头开始构建这个算法而不必记住它?
我正在使用Apache POi HSSF库将信息导入我的应用程序.问题是文件有一些额外/空行需要在解析之前先删除.
没有HSSFSheet.removeRow( int rowNum )方法.只有removeRow( HSSFRow row ).这个问题是无法删除空行.例如:
sheet.removeRow( sheet.getRow(rowNum) );
Run Code Online (Sandbox Code Playgroud)
在空行上给出NullPointerException,因为getRow()返回null.另外,正如我在论坛上看到的那样,removeRow()只删除单元格内容,但行仍然是空行.
有没有一种方法可以删除行(空或不)而不创建一个没有我要删除的行的全新工作表?
我正在寻找一个好的工具,可以采用完整的邮件地址,格式化显示或与邮件标签一起使用,并将其转换为结构化对象.
例如:
// Start with a formatted address in a single string
string f = "18698 E. Main Street\r\nBig Town, AZ, 86011";
// Parse into address
Address addr = new Address(f);
addr.Street; // 18698 E. Main Street
addr.Locality; // Big Town
addr.Region; // AZ
addr.PostalCode; // 86011
Run Code Online (Sandbox Code Playgroud)
现在我可以使用RegEx来做到这一点.但棘手的部分是保持它足够通用,以处理世界上的任何地址!
我确信必须有一些可以做到的东西.
如果有人注意到,这实际上是opensocial.address对象的格式.
我有一个问题,我想知道你的意见.
我正在尝试使用Repository Pattern.我有一个存储库对象,可以将数据加载到POCO.我还创建了一个业务逻辑层,它增加了一些功能但基本上包装了POCO.所以最后我有一个BLL,它使用存储库来加载DAO.
我对这个解决方案不是很满意.我有三层,但我觉得BLL没有提供enought功能来保持它.另一方面,我不想把我的逻辑放在存储库层或数据访问层?
所以我的问题是我应该在哪里应用逻辑?你使用哪种解决方案(DAO + repo或DAO + BLL + rep或其他任何解决方案)?